Plaga Zombie (1997)

Horror | 69 minutes
2,75 8 votes

Genre: Horror

Duration: 69 minuten

Alternative title: Plaga Zombie - The Beginning

Country: Argentina

Directed by: Pablo Parés and Hernán Sáez

Stars: Berta Muñiz, Pablo Parés and Hernán Sáez

IMDb score: 5,5 (545)

Releasedate: 1 January 1997

Plaga Zombie plot

The dead rise again from their graves and begin a massacre. A wrestler, a Star Trek fan and a medical student team up to battle these bloodthirsty zombies.

Sort of Argentinian Bad Taste Very cool! Doesn't look all that great, but the incredibly crazy camera work makes it all very entertaining. Lots of colorful gore that would look better today (quality) but nevertheless remains nicely cheeky and quirky.

Too bad about the terrible soundtrack. Otherwise this is a find for the real underground work in the horror genre. Home garden and kitchen movie that turns out to be very funny, smooth and dirty. I am now very curious about the sequel from 2001!

Disappointing Argentinian no-budget mix of Bad Taste (1987) and Dèmoni (1985).

The film is apparently supposed to be very funny (boxing scene, karate scene, juggling with brains, the overacting and exaggerated sounds of the zombies), but actually very rarely is. In terms of gore, it is actually all rather meager. The best scene is in the beginning of the film (the boy who wakes up with all that skin sticking to his bed). For the rest, the kills are not creative enough. Most of the kills are done by means of syringes. The last 10 minutes make up for that a little, but by then the damage has already been done.

For a film that lasts barely 60 minutes, it's all very boring. Not so surprising, because if the gore and humor aren't good enough, then you're not left with much of a film that was apparently made for 120 dollars. Andreas Schnaas does that a bit better, from what I've seen of him so far. I don't think he would have done that potentially great kill with the lawnmower off-screen either.

Respect for the enthusiasm of the cast and crew to start such a project with pretty much no budget, but I honestly found the result to be very mediocre. Too little over the top gore and unsuccessful humor. Strangely enough, it is considered by fans of no-budget shot-on-video fans as one of the nicer SOV movies. It also gets a very decent rating here and on IMDB in that respect.

An Argentinian SOV zombie horror, low budget too, then you shouldn't really pay attention to the quality or the chaotic images of course. I mainly noticed that they had a lot of fun with it, that's something too, but that doesn't mean it was all good either.

Especially in terms of content, a lot of chaos. As if they wanted to add a lot of horror elements that didn't necessarily have to do with zombies. For example, vomiting zombies or zombies that start slashing. There was very little line in it. Not very consistent either and too much of a jumble. Oh yeah, at the same time they also wanted to be funny.

Some blood and gore, not always visually top, but filth is filth, one might have thought. Fortunately, this one only lasts a little over an hour, which was more than enough.
